If you adjust your lights attenuation radius to inside the room to something inside the room does this issue still happen?
You may look into converting the BSP’s to static mesh’s and adjusting the light map resolution to something like 512. Typically BSP’s are meant to be building blocks witch which to block out levels with. Getting a general Sense of how the flow of the level is going to go and where future assets will be placed. Also, creating walls that are not part of the ceiling can also cause this. In the future you may want to make your walls and ceiling out of one “Additive” BSP and hollow out the room with a subtractive BSP.
